Why TFmini Is Being Phased Out

TFmini was widely adopted due to its compact structure and accessible cost, making it suitable for early-stage sensing projects. However, as applications matured, users began to encounter limitations related to frame rate, interference handling, and interface flexibility. For fixed-installation scenarios such as berth guidance or collision prevention systems, these constraints can affect long-term operational reliability. As system architectures become more refined, the need for improved signal stability and faster data feedback has become more prominent.

What Makes TFmini-S a Practical Upgrade

TFmini-S12 m LiDAR Ranging Module addresses many of the practical concerns raised by earlier deployments. TFmini-S is a low-cost, compact, and lightweight micro LiDAR sensor with an enhanced frame rate. This mini LiDAR has versatile interfaces for various platforms, catering to diverse customer needs in short-range applications. With improved ranging consistency and better adaptability to controlled outdoor and semi-industrial environments, it offers a smoother upgrade path for projects previously relying on tf mini lidar, without requiring major structural redesigns.

Product Positioning in Real Applications

Within the broader Benewake lidar portfolio, TFmini-S fits into fixed and semi-fixed sensing setups such as obstacle detection, position feedback, and proximity monitoring. Its interface options allow easier integration into existing control systems used by equipment manufacturers and solution providers. For teams maintaining legacy TFmini-based designs, TFmini-S enables continuity while supporting updated performance expectations.
